The race for best documentary feature at the Academy Awards began last night at the 1st Critic’s Choice Documentary Awards. The rest of the critics have agreed and confirmed their praise of O.J.: Made in America during the inaugural ceremony held last night at BRIC, in Brooklyn, New York.

The film was the top winner with four awards in total, including Best Documentary, Best Direction, Best Limited Doc Series and Best Sports Documentary.
On the TV/streaming side, Ava DuVernay’s 13th took home the most awards with Best Documentary, Best Direction, and Best Political Documentary.
